Abstract: Abstract A new oxime-based hexanuclear MnIII complex containing the structural core [Mn6III(μ3-O)2] was synthesized through a general route. We describe the preparation and characterization of the manganese(III) complex [Mn6III(μ3-O)2(Salox)6(CH3CH2OH)4{(CH3)3CCOO}2] by X-ray diffraction (XRD), X-ray photoelectron spectroscopy (XPS) and X-ray absorption spectroscopy (XAS). Therefore we offer the first core level XPS, and XAS reference spectra of polynuclear complexes comprising only Mn(III) ions in octahedral surrounding.

Abstract: While assigning sentences their so-called tectogrammatical representation, annotators of the Prague Dependency Treebank are also creating a valency lexicon of Czech verbs, nouns and adjectives. Until now, the information contained in it has only been used for visual checking of consistency of valency frame assigned by the annotators. We have developed an automatic procedure for pre-annotation of verbal modifications using this valency lexicon. When adding nodes into the tectogrammatical representation of sentences, our tool substantially increases the baseline recall, at the cost of only small decrease of precision.
